The most frequent issue is hinges.

There are a few issues that UPVC windows may face, most notably jammed hinges or rusted. They can be fixed without having to replace the entire window. The best solution is to simply buy new hinges.

If the sash is dragging and the hinges are not moving, they could be stuck or wear excessively. It is possible to fix this by turning the hinge. Oil can also be used on the hinges.

Draughts can be caused by a variety of factors, including the sag of the window frame. If this is so, you need to locate the loosening bolt and take it off. Replace the screw after you have removed it.

Sometimes, the sash can also drop. This could be due to an error in the alignment of the handle or sash. It is possible to fix a jammed sash by turning the hinge or using dowels.

UPVC window hinges are available in a range of sizes. They are generally sold in inches, however they are also available in millimetres. To ensure that you get the right size, measure the arm of the hinge before you buy.

Paint on uPVC windows can void warranty

You might paint your uPVC windows to change their look. A fresh look can be created for a fraction the cost of new windows. However, be sure you do the job properly.

You should first make sure that your uPVC windows are clean and free of dust, dirt, grime and grease. These could affect the adhesion to paint. After you have cleaned the surface, you can apply a coat of primer. Dry it out before applying the next coat.

Vinyl-safe paints should be used. Oil-based paints will not work on plastic surfaces. Using a high-quality brush to complete the task will ensure that your finish is smooth. Be sure to get rid of any brush strokes that are visible through the paint.

Sand your uPVC before painting it. Sanding will increase the surface's energy and help to stick the paint.

Paint should be applied in two coats, and the final coat should be allowed to dry before taking off the masking tape. Sheets of plastic should also be used to protect the floors and walls.

Avoid using acetone or any other abrasive cleaners. Acetone will degrade the molecular structure of uPVC. This can cause paint flaking or peeling.

A professional should be employed to complete the work. This will give you the best results. Not only will you receive an attractive, smooth finish, but you'll also be protected from the weather. Professional uPVC spray painters offer 10 years of UV warranty.
